Princess Masie and the Golden Seashell

Princess Masie the Mermaid woke up at dawn by the sparkling lake. She lived near tall trees in the Enchanted Forest. Her tail shimmered in soft pastel green and pink. She was kind and brave but also very curious. She loved collecting shiny shells on the water’s edge. She had a special golden seashell necklace.

One morning she gasped in surprise. Her golden seashell was gone. She touched her neck with a worried look. She felt a small pang in her heart. She must find her treasure. She called softly for help. A gentle voice answered her call.

It was Teddy Bear her best friend. Teddy Bear hopped out from behind a mossy rock. He was soft and fluffy with a friendly smile. He wore a little red bow. He loved adventures with Masie. Masie told him her golden seashell had vanished. Teddy Bear’s eyes grew wide.

“We can find it,” he said in a cheerful tone. Masie felt hope bloom inside her. Together they set off along a winding path. Sunbeams sparkled through the emerald leaves overhead. Birds sang gentle songs in the branches. Masie hummed a happy tune to calm her nerves. Teddy held her fin softly to guide her. They walked past tall ferns and mushrooms. They reached a clear puddle that glowed pink.

Masie knelt down to look. But the seashell was not there. Teddy sniffed the air curiously. A hidden path led deeper into the woods. Masie felt her heart beat fast. She squeezed Teddy’s paw gently. They followed the winding trail.

Soon they heard soft footsteps behind them. A dusty boot stepped on a fallen leaf. They froze in surprise. A Bandit peeked from behind a tree. He wore a tattered coat and a sly grin. In his hand he held a small bag. The bag jingled with something bright. Masie felt a flutter of fear. Teddy stood by her side bravely.

“Please stop,” Masie said in a calm voice. The Bandit frowned in confusion. “Who dares speak to me here?” he growled. “I am Masie,” she said in a soft tone. “That bag may hold my golden seashell.” The Bandit tilted his head. He loosened the bag’s knot. Out spilled many trinkets and shiny stones. At the bottom lay the golden seashell.

Masie’s eyes shone with relief. She stepped forward slowly. “That is mine,” she said kindly. The Bandit paused and looked at her. She offered him a small pearl she carried. Teddy Bear gave a gentle hug to Masie. The Bandit listened to her offer. His frown turned into a small smile. He nodded and returned the golden seashell.

Masie felt joy fill her chest. She thanked the Bandit warmly. “Take this pearl,” she said in a cheerful voice. “It may bring you luck.” The Bandit bowed his head. He tucked the pearl in his coat. “Thank you,” he whispered. Then he vanished into the shadows. Masie held her seashell close.

She touched its smooth surface. It glowed softly in her hand. Teddy Bear beamed at her. “We did it,” he cheered. Masie smiled and laughed. Together they headed back to the lake. The water sparkled like diamonds in the sun. Masie placed the golden seashell on her shelf. She felt proud and safe.

Teddy Bear clapped his little paws. Masie made him a tiny seashell crown. He wore it with delight. They danced in the shallow water. Birds chirped with happiness above them. Masie tucked the golden seashell necklace around her neck. She felt happy and strong. She had found her treasure. She had made a new friend.

The Bandit had learned kindness too. Masie and Teddy Bear agreed to share more adventures. They waved goodbye to the Enchanted Forest. Night fell softly around the lake. Fireflies glowed like tiny stars. Masie and Teddy Bear sat by the shore. They watched the sky turn pink and purple. Masie felt safe and content. Teddy Bear snuggled by her side.

She whispered, “Good night, my friend.” The forest sang a gentle lullaby. Masie closed her eyes with a smile. She dreamed of new treasures to find tomorrow.

In her dreams she saw glowing pearls under mossy rocks. She felt the wind whisper through the treetops. She imagined the bandit finding joy in his new pearl. She imagined a moonlit dance on the lake. Teddy Bear yawned and blinked. They felt the forest wrap them in warmth. A gentle breeze carried soft petals on the air.

Masie dreamed of helping more creatures. She dreamed of finding hidden treasures. She dreamed of telling stories to new friends. She woke at dawn with a bright smile. The forest greeted her with green leaves. Birds fluttered around her with new songs. She held Teddy Bear close and whispered promises. “Tomorrow we will explore deeper,” she said in joy. They set off hand in paw into a new day. The Enchanted Forest glowed with endless possibility.
